Unable to enter network details in Arduino Cloud

Hi
I am trying to set up a R4 Wifi on the cloud.
Created a "THING" and associated a device.
The option to enter network details is not selectable.
Can anyone help with this?

Hi @anon6686873. Please try this workaround for the problem:

  1. If you are not already, log in to your Arduino account:
    https://login.arduino.cc/login
  2. Click the following link to open the list of your Arduino Cloud Things in the web browser:
    https://app.arduino.cc/things
  3. Click the name of the Thing.
    The "Setup" page for the Thing will open.
  4. Click the "Detach" button under the "Associated Device" section of the page.
  5. Click the "Select Device" button under the "Associated Device" section of the page.
    The "Associate device" dialog will open.
  6. Select the UNO R4 WiFi Device from the dialog.
    The dialog will close.

You should now be able to click the "Configure" button under the "Network" section of the page, and configure your network credentials.
